~Despite 11 finishes this month already (and a few things started but not finished!), I have added another WiP to my list.  You see, I am yet to make what they call a 'Granny' square - so I have decided to jump straight in and go one better and make a 'Great Granny' square instead!!
This simply means that there is an extra ring of squares: a baby square, a mama ring of squares, a ring of granny squares and then on this block you add one more ring of squares and call it a 'Great Granny'.  Clever I say and it also means the block becomes 12.5" unfinished - so my quilt will come together that much faster!  So, I will be following the Great Granny Along with Bee in My Bonnet and Pleasant Home.  They are already in week two but hopefully that won't stop me from catching up...
